In the laboratory: Equipment

Butterfly needles with built-in safety features continued

  • Two examples of butterfly needles with built-in safety devices are shown.
  • The Punctur-Guardâ„¢ (Bioplexus), shown above, uses an internal blunt needle which is activated after blood is drawn. The activated device showing the blunt internal needle is shown in the inset on the upper right.
  • The Angel Wing â„¢ (Monoject), is activated by sliding a safety shield over the needle after venipuncture.
